AMPLIFIER FEATuRES
The US-Series features four professional heavy-duty power amplifiers, covering a wide range of
output power ratings. The models are US-1200, US-1800, US-3000 and US-4000. US-Series
amplifiers are built on a rugged, heavy gauge steel chassis with a sturdy aluminum front panel.
The amplifiers use advanced circuitry and a well-designed PCB layout to ensure quality sound
and enhanced reliability. Large aluminum heatsinks and an oversized toroidal transformer, com-
bined with comprehensive protection circuitry and variable speed fan(s) provide worry-free and
reliable operation in the most demanding environments.
